For more flex/suspension travel in the WL, the suspension has to be in the second to highest setting. More travel means more traction. This also will help make use of the disconnectable sway bar. The highest setting is meant for clearing an obstacle a tall obstacle then going back down to the second highest level. Also if he was in 4 Low, the transmission starts out in 2nd gear so the driver will have to manually shift in to 1st if they want lower gearing in 4 Low. Glad to see a new WL out having fun.

@@Andremx12 I'm running 265 65 17. (30.6 inches) with a 2 inch teraflex lift . 0.75 inch wheel spacers . This is a regular 2016 Cherokee Trailhawk not a grand Cherokee Trailhawk. Very minimal fender liner rub , no suspension arm rub (because the wheel spacers fixed that completely) no pinch weld mod or trimming. Breakover angle after lift and tires is 28°. Approach and departure are both over 35° or higher. I also added 1.25 inch spring rubbers in the front and 1 inch spring rubbers in the rear. This causes NO change to ride height but does improve functional (while moving) ground clearance due to the fact that it basically converts the suspension to progressive rate. Handling is also DRAMATICALLY improved. I also use a front strut tower brace as the one for the dodge dart I'd an identical match. Off road tire pressure is 26 PSI , on road is 29 PSI (this is the correct street pressure with the larger tires according to load inflation tables. This holds the same load or more as the stock tires did at 36 psi). Interestingly, I had no loss in corner travel index at 22 psi even though the springs are stiffer with the rubbers. I can't explain it but that was the result.
